Some businesses will need additional features like inventory management, payroll capabilities, dedicated budgeting features, and cash flow analysis. Smaller businesses may only need simple bookkeeping capabilities, and can forego the Online Bookkeeping more advanced reporting, inventory management, and other capabilities. Some companies may require a comprehensive ERP (Enterprise Resource Planning) system, rather than a solution that focuses exclusively on accounting.

The earned wage access (EWA) capability allows employees to receive up to half of their pay as many as two days before their scheduled payday. The wages are transferred to a Paycor-issued Visa card and are accessible from the Paycor mobile app’s wallet.
